In this enchanting collection, renowned author and naturalist John Graves paints a vivid and evocative portrait of the Lone Star State's rural charms. Through a series of personal essays and thoughtful ruminations, he invites readers to witness the changing seasons, celebrate the unique customs, and embrace the enduring spirit of the people who call this land their home.
A Tapestry of Landscapes and Lives
From the rugged hills of the Hill Country to the vast openness of the Panhandle, Graves's words paint a vivid tapestry of the state's diverse geography. His descriptions of the windswept prairies and sparkling waterways capture the essence of the natural beauty that surrounds the people of Texas.
But "Some Essays And Other Ruminations About Country Life In Texas" is not merely a collection of nature essays. It is also a celebration of the lives lived within these landscapes. Graves introduces us to farmers, ranchers, cowboys, and other characters who embody the spirit of rural Texas.
Celebrating Tradition and Progress
Through his stories, Graves highlights the importance of tradition and continuity in a rapidly changing world. He recounts the cowboy's code of honor, the rituals of small-town life, and the resilience of communities during times of hardship.
At the same time, Graves acknowledges the challenges and opportunities that come with modernization. He discusses the impact of technological advancements on rural communities and the changing lifestyles of its residents.
